Executive Casino Host – Golden Entertainment, Inc. Location: The Strat, Las Vegas, NV

Salary: $55,000.00 – $75,000.00 (Full time)

Responsibilities

Meets or exceeds all revenue and associated goals assigned by the Player Development department

Ensures the highest possible standards of guest service and listens to and responds to guest concerns and questions

Recommends and implements strategies to develop new players and promote return visits for high-level casino guests to increase profits

Supports VIP Services by making room reservations, suite determinations, amenities, and limo arrangements as necessary for casino guests; completes all necessary paperwork (i.e. bill backs, comp slips, reservation request forms, etc.) and greets guests upon arrival whenever possible

Make appropriate business decisions, complimentary based on recorded play, earned points, comp availability and customer profitability

Actively develops and maintains guest loyalty and incremental visitation through personal contact such as on-property hosting, off-property entertaining, telemarketing, direct mail, and email using available amenities and promotional opportunities

Able to regain guest loyalty under difficult circumstances

Proactively reestablishes relationship with former VIP guests through various marketing programs

Maintains current knowledge of all events, promotions, and special functions by reviewing all available information to provide guests with accurate information, answer questions, handle special requests, and aid guests in enjoying the best possible experience and ensure guest satisfaction

Develops and maintains an active player list within criteria guidelines established for executive hosts

Proactively seeks out new business, within the sourcing guidelines established for Executive Host position, on the casino floor, introducing the benefits of and soliciting enrollment for the ace PLAY Player’s Club

Devotes significant time being visible and available on the casino floor to meet and greet guests during individual visits as well as during special events

Supports casino related departments with guest needs

Prioritizes, organizes, and completes multiple activities in a high-pressure environment and works a varying schedule to reflect business needs

Ensures compliance with all applicable gaming laws and company internal controls, policies and procedures, Title 31, and federal regulations

Completes tasks with minimal supervision and within deadlines

Must be able to maintain a pleasant, friendly, and welcoming attitude at all times

Other duties as assigned
